Understanding Technical Specification Documents
A technical specification document is a comprehensive description of the technical requirements and design specifications for a product, system, or project. It usually serves as a formal agreement between clients, developers, and other stakeholders outlining what is to be built, how it should function, and the standards it must meet. Understanding the purpose and structure of this document is essential for ensuring project success and avoiding misunderstandings during development.
Purpose and Importance
The primary purpose of a technical specification document is to provide a clear, detailed, and unambiguous description of the technical aspects of a project. This includes defining functionalities, operating conditions, performance criteria, and compliance requirements. It acts as a reference point throughout the project lifecycle, helping to align expectations and guide the development team.
Who Uses Technical Specification Documents?
Technical specification documents are utilized by various professionals including project managers, engineers, developers, quality assurance teams, and clients. Each group relies on the document to understand their roles, responsibilities, and the technical constraints involved in the project. This ensures that everyone works towards a unified goal.
Key Components of a Technical Specification Document Sample
A well-crafted technical specification document sample typically includes several critical components to ensure clarity and thoroughness. These components collectively define the scope, functionality, design, and constraints of the project.
Introduction and Purpose
This section provides an overview of the project, its objectives, and the intended audience for the document. It sets the context and explains why the specification is necessary.
Scope and Overview
Here, the boundaries of the project are defined, including what is included and excluded. It outlines the overall system or product architecture and major features.
Functional Requirements
This part details the specific functions the system or product must perform. It includes use cases, user interactions, and system operations.
Technical Requirements
Technical requirements describe hardware, software, and network specifications. They may also cover performance criteria, security standards, and compliance considerations.
Design Specifications
Design specifications include diagrams, data models, and interface descriptions that illustrate how the system will be constructed and integrated.
Constraints and Assumptions
Any limitations, such as budget, time, technology, or resource restrictions, are documented here. Assumptions made during the specification process are also listed.
Acceptance Criteria
These criteria define the conditions under which the delivered product or system will be accepted by the client or stakeholders.
Glossary and References
A glossary explains technical terms and acronyms, while references provide additional documentation or standards relevant to the specification.
How to Create an Effective Technical Specification Document
Creating a technical specification document sample requires careful planning, clear communication, and attention to detail. The process involves gathering requirements, analyzing stakeholder needs, and translating them into technical language.
Requirement Gathering
Effective requirement gathering is the foundation of a successful technical specification. It involves engaging with clients, users, and technical teams to identify all necessary features and constraints.
Structuring the Document
A clear and logical structure helps users navigate the document easily. Using standardized templates and consistent formatting improves readability and comprehension.
Writing Clear and Concise Content
Technical language should be precise yet accessible to all intended readers. Avoiding ambiguity and providing detailed explanations helps prevent misunderstandings.
Review and Validation
Once drafted, the document should be reviewed by all stakeholders for accuracy and completeness. Validation ensures that the specifications meet the project goals and technical standards.
Examples and Templates of Technical Specification Documents
Using examples and templates of technical specification documents can greatly assist in producing a high-quality specification. These samples provide a practical framework that can be adapted to various projects and industries.
Common Formats and Templates
Templates often follow a structured layout including sections for introduction, requirements, design, and testing. They may be available in formats such as Word documents or spreadsheets for easy customization.
Sample Technical Specification Document Overview
A typical sample document might include detailed descriptions of software modules, hardware components, performance benchmarks, and interface requirements. It serves as a reference for best practices and standard documentation techniques.
Industry-Specific Examples
Technical specification documents vary by industry. For example, software development specifications focus on code architecture and API requirements, while manufacturing specifications emphasize material properties and production processes.
Benefits of Using a Technical Specification Document Sample
Utilizing a technical specification document sample offers numerous advantages that contribute to project efficiency and quality assurance.
Enhanced Communication
A well-defined specification document ensures clear communication among stakeholders, reducing the risk of misinterpretation and errors.
Improved Project Planning
With detailed technical requirements outlined, project managers can better estimate timelines, resources, and costs.
Risk Mitigation
Identifying constraints and acceptance criteria early helps mitigate potential risks and facilitates smoother project execution.
Quality Assurance
The document provides benchmarks for testing and validation, ensuring the final product meets the specified standards.
Reusable Framework
Using a technical specification document sample as a template saves time and effort in future projects by providing a proven documentation structure.
